Evaluation of vitamin D status and its correlation with gonadal function in children at mini-puberty
Clinical Endocrinology Sep 25, 2018
Kilinç S, et al. - Researchers performed this cross-sectional cohort analysis to describe the relationships between 25(OH)D levels and gonadal hormones at mini-puberty (defined as hypothalamic-pituitary-gonadal axis activation during the first 6 months of life) by analyzing data from 180 (94 boys and 86 girls) healthy appropriate-for-gestational age neonates. They identified a modest effect of 25(OH)D on total testosterone and inhibin B in girls at mini-puberty. During early life, 25(OH)D might have an effect on gonadal function. In 25(OH)D deficient vs sufficient girls, total testosterone level was higher and inhibin B was lower.
